Anastasia Beverly Hills Norvina Eyeshadow Palette Review & Swatches

anastasia norvina eyeshadow palette

 

One of the most exciting beauty launches this Summer is the Anastasia Beverly Hills Norvina Eyeshadow Palette ($42). It’s composed of 14 shades; seven unique and gorgeous shimmers plus seven summer-ready wearable bright mattes. The lavender-colored packaging of this eyeshadow palette looks so unique and so beautiful at first glance, and the shades are as magical and whimsical as Norvina Soare’s lavender-purple hair.

Each of the shade feels buttery soft and smooth, and they’re all easy to apply and blend. The shimmers apply seamlessly and I noticed no fallouts. I find the colors to be buildable and they stay put for a long time, with or without any eye primer. The matte shades, on the other hand, are easy to wear and they fit well with most skin tones. Also, they complement the shimmery colors nicely.

Anastasia Beverly Hills Sun Dipped Glow Kit Review + Swatches

If you’re looking for a palette full of well-crafted highlighters with different tones, well, look no further because this Glow Kit from Anastasia Beverly Hills ($40) might just be the answer you’re looking for, especially if you’re crazy over highlighters nowadays.

Anastasia Beverly Hills Sun Dipped Glow Kit

Bronzed – This is a shimmery bronze-gold that can work as a bronzer or as a golden highlighter for different skin tones, but I think this is specially meant for medium to dark skin tones as well. This is really shimmery and if you wanna look super gilded like the queen of the Nile, then this one’s for you.

 

Summer – A pearly-gold shimmer for those with lighter complexions. This really highlights your cheekbones and all the bony prominences of your face.

 

Tourmaline – A rosy shimmer that’s a bit similar to Becca’s Shimmering Skin Perfector in Opal. I love this shade because it’s not too bright and not dark for a highlighter. A great complement to any light-medium skin tones.

 

Moonstone – This is a blend of peachy-pearl-golden shimmer that appeared to be very similar to the Summer shade once applied on my light-medium skin. In fact, it’s hard for me to tell the difference between the two. The difference between them is very subtle, but this is for sure a better option for those with light to medium complexion if you’re looking to level up your highlighter shade but doesn’t want a pure pearly shimmer on your face.

 

 

Anastasia Beverly Hills Sun Dipped Glow Kit review

These highlighters are well-pigmented and they’re really shimmery. You can layer them for sure, but I find that just a single swipe of a fan brush or a finger will already give an instant glow. They’re easy to blend, so that’s a big plus, but I find that they’re a bit more shimmery when compared to Becca’s Shimmering Skin Perfectors (reviewed HERE), yet they’re also as finely-milled and soft.
